E-Tenders and Tendering - 

Understanding and Accessing the Public Procurement Processes

One of the best ways for Irish SMEs to grow sales is to understand how to win more tenders to public sector buyers. Public procurement contests follow a formal, structured process. They have strict criteria for qualification and award, and can seem complicated and difficult to understand. This programme will demystify the tendering process and help businesses to write better bids to improve their chances of winning more contracts.

An introductory programme, the online interactive workshop will equip participants with the tools to navigate the public sector marketing place and to understand the process of how to bid effectively for public sector opportunities.

Course Content

Topic 1: Navigating the public sector market place:

This module steps through the eTenders website to make sure participants understand how they can find useful information that can help understand where opportunities lie and what needs to be done to begin targeting the right opportunities.

 

Objectives of the session:

• Understanding the differences between quotations and tenders.

• Introduce the data sources and navigating eTenders.

• Useful information – previous RFTs and contract award information.

 

Module outcomes:

• Aware of how to access public opportunities.

 • Familiar with eTenders website.

• Participants will understand how to find useful information.

 

Module Content:

• Public Procurement processes –the difference between quoting for contracts below the tendering thresholds and tendering for contracts above the threshold.

Topic 2: Bid Management – what to do and how to do it:

This module explores the process to be followed to bid effectively and focus on what buyers look for from bidders.

This module also explains the scoring criteria and how to interpret them.  

 

Objectives of session:

• To develop an appreciation of what buyers look for from bidders.

• To explain scoring criteria and how to interpret them.

 

Module Outcomes:

• Clear understanding of when to bid and why.

• Clear understanding of what a good bid looks like.

 

Module Content:

 • Qualifying criteria vs. award criteria – the difference between such criteria and how buyers use the criteria.

• Breaking out the requirements in a tender document. Taking an example of tender documents and showing how the requirements can be identified.

 • Stepping through the “classic” sections of a bid and what needs to be outlined in each (introduction, requirements table, approach, methodology, citations, pricing, appendices etc.).
